(NO 3360 2336) Birkhill House (NAT)
OS 6" map (1959)
Birkhill (NO 3360 2336 ) which was very extensively improved and enlarged in 1857-9, was built in 1780 on the site of the old house owned by the Leslies, which is mentioned in a charter of 1601. A remnant of the old building, notable for the thickness of its walls, was in existence 'till the 1859 improvements.
J Campbell 1894
No further information. No evidence of 17th century building.
Visited by OS (RD) 11 June 1970
